The Capabilities of AI: What Can Artificial Intelligence Do?
Artificial intelligence (AI) has become a transformative force across various industries, revolutionizing how we live, work, and interact with technology. From enhancing productivity to offering personalized experiences, AI’s potential seems limitless. But what exactly can AI do today? Let’s explore some of its key capabilities.
Automation and Efficiency
One of the most significant contributions of AI is its ability to automate repetitive tasks. In industries like manufacturing, finance, and customer service, AI systems can handle mundane tasks with precision and speed. This not only increases efficiency but also allows human workers to focus on more complex and creative aspects of their jobs.
Data Analysis and Insights
AI excels at processing large volumes of data quickly and accurately. By analyzing patterns within data sets, AI can provide valuable insights that drive decision-making in businesses. For instance, in healthcare, AI algorithms can analyze medical records to predict patient outcomes or suggest treatment plans.
Natural Language Processing
Natural language processing (NLP) enables machines to understand and respond to human language. This technology powers virtual assistants like Siri and Alexa, which can perform tasks ranging from setting reminders to answering questions. NLP is also used in chatbots that provide customer support by understanding queries and delivering relevant information.
Image and Speech Recognition
AI’s ability to recognize images and speech has numerous applications. In security systems, facial recognition technology enhances safety measures by identifying individuals in real-time. Similarly, speech recognition software is used in transcription services and voice-controlled devices.
Personalization
AI tailors experiences based on individual preferences by analyzing user behavior. Streaming services like Netflix use AI algorithms to recommend shows based on viewing history. E-commerce platforms deploy similar technologies to suggest products that align with a customer’s past purchases or browsing habits.

Understand the capabilities and limitations of AI technology.
When considering the use of AI technology, it’s crucial to understand both its capabilities and limitations. AI excels in processing large datasets, recognizing patterns, and automating repetitive tasks, making it invaluable in fields like data analysis, customer service, and healthcare. However, it’s important to recognize that AI systems are only as good as the data they are trained on and can sometimes produce biased or inaccurate results if that data is flawed. Additionally, while AI can simulate certain aspects of human intelligence, such as problem-solving and language processing, it lacks true understanding and consciousness. Therefore, setting realistic expectations about what AI can achieve is essential for effectively integrating it into various applications while remaining mindful of ethical considerations and potential biases.
Ensure data quality for better AI performance.
Ensuring data quality is crucial for optimizing AI performance, as the effectiveness of AI systems heavily depends on the quality of the data they are trained on. High-quality data is accurate, complete, consistent, and relevant, which enables AI models to learn effectively and make precise predictions or decisions. Poor data quality can lead to biased outcomes, errors, and unreliable results, undermining the potential benefits of AI applications. By prioritizing data integrity through thorough cleaning, validation, and management processes, organizations can enhance the accuracy and reliability of their AI systems, ultimately driving better insights and more informed decision-making.

Implement security measures to protect AI systems from cyber threats.
As AI systems become increasingly integral to various industries, implementing robust security measures is essential to protect them from cyber threats. These systems often handle sensitive data and perform critical functions, making them attractive targets for malicious actors. To safeguard AI systems, organizations should employ a multi-layered security approach that includes encryption, access controls, and regular vulnerability assessments. Additionally, incorporating anomaly detection algorithms can help identify suspicious activities in real-time. By prioritizing security, businesses can ensure the integrity and reliability of their AI applications while maintaining user trust and compliance with regulatory standards.
